Local Attractions – Hidden Gems of Sydney

While Sydney’s famous landmarks are a must-visit, some lesser-known attractions promise an unforgettable experience. The Royal Botanic Gardens, tucked away near the Opera House, offers breathtaking views of the harbour and city skyline. The Art Gallery of New South Wales boasts an extensive collection of classic and contemporary art, including indigenous art. The White Rabbit Gallery, a converted warehouse in Chippendale, houses one of the world’s largest collections of contemporary Chinese art.

If you’re craving some time in nature, visit the secluded Milk Beach, tucked away in Hermit Bay, for a private beach experience. Take a scenic ferry ride to Cockatoo Island for a unique glamping experience within a UNESCO World Heritage site.

Dining spots – Savor Local Cuisine and Discover Sydney’s Food Culture

Sydney’s food culture is as diverse and eclectic as its population, with flavors ranging from Burgers to Chinese to Indian. Quay, a Modern Australian restaurant in the Rocks has a view of the Opera House and Harbour Bridge while you dine. For the freshest seafood with a view, head to Fish at the Rocks.

For a truly local experience, try a pie at Harry’s Cafe De Wheels, an 80-year-old institution serving delicious savory pies and hotdogs. Visit the iconic Fish Market in Pyrmont for fresh seafood directly from the boats. And don’t forget to try the city’s famous chocolate cake – the “Belgium Chocolate Delight” at The Grounds of Alexandria.

Cultural Experiences – Traditions and Celebrations of Sydney

One of Sydney’s most important cultural celebrations is the Vivid Festival, a light show that takes place every year from May to June. During the festival, the walls of the Opera House illuminate, and installations light-up landmarks, reflecting the city’s art scene.

For immersive cultural experiences, head to the Museum of Contemporary Art and the Australian Museum. Take a stroll through Chinatown or Little Italy and explore cultural markets selling traditional foods, fashion, and other merchandise.

Local History – Uncovering Stories from Sydney’s Past

Sydney’s history dates back to early indigenous settlements. The Rocks precinct is home to some of the oldest buildings in Australia and, once a bustling port, was the birthplace of the city’s working-class culture. The MCA at Circular Quay was once the site of Australia’s first Government House.

Visit the Justice and Police Museum to learn about the city’s dark history of crime and punishment. Explore the Hyde Park Barracks Museum and see the exhibits detailing the lives of convicts who built Sydney.

Off-the-beaten-path suggestions – Discovering Sydney’s Unique Experiences

For a unique experience, hike through the secluded trail from Coogee to Bondi and take in the stunning coastal views. Take an early-morning dip at the Bronte Baths and watch the sunrise from the ocean.

Head to Carraigeworks, a contemporary arts center, to experience avant-garde music, dance, and theatre performances. Catch a glimpse into Indigenous culture by visiting the Blak Markets in La Perouse, selling authentic handmade crafts, and bush tucker.
